Everybody knows denim game be real stressful. I’ve been on the hunt for a nice pair of selvedge jeans that doesn’t make my ass look flat as an ipad. I don’t know why I’ve always overlooked jeans from J. crew, but J. Crew joints are extremely soft, probably 10oz denim so it’s not the heaviest denim, but that makes it so much more softer. Most of the selvedge denim I have (Gap, Tellason, 7, Levis) are quite heavy and stiff, but these feel almost broken in already, they feel similar to the 501s i’ve had for over 3 years. I’m normally a 32 waist but like most jcrew stuff, they tend to run a bit big so I opted for the 31. The waist fits perfectly and the thighs have maybe half a centimeter of room to breathe, which is perfect. The sales rep at the store assured me that the jeans are not even broken in yet, and after a few wears that the waist and leg openings will break in nicely. its too damn hot to wear jeans during the day, but im hoping to get some wears during the evenings.
On that note, anyone know if selvedged denim can be tapered like any other jeans? Do I have to give the tailor any special instructions when doing this?
No taper needed, just did some measuring and with a 7.75” hem, I think this is perfect for my frame. I don’t want to look like there are twigs holding up this ~180lbs of MAN.
